Zooming In On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d's Earnings

As finance nerds would already know, the accrual ratio from cashflow is a key measure for assessing how well a company's free cash flow (FCF) matches its profit. In plain english, this ratio subtracts FCF from net profit, and divides that number by the company's average operating assets over that period. You could think of the accrual ratio from cashflow as the 'non-FCF profit ratio'.

That means a negative accrual ratio is a good thing, because it shows that the company is bringing in more free cash flow than its profit would suggest. While it's not a problem to have a positive accrual ratio, indicating a certain level of non-cash profits, a high accrual ratio is arguably a bad thing, because it indicates paper profits are not matched by cash flow. That's because some academic studies have suggested that high accruals ratios tend to lead to lower profit or less profit growth.

For the year to September 2023,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d had an accrual ratio of 0.22. Therefore, we know that it's free cashflow was significantly lower than its statutory profit, which is hardly a good thing. In the last twelve months it actually had negative free cash flow, with an outflow of CN¥118m despite its profit of CN¥96.4m, mentioned above. We saw that FCF was CN¥40m a year ago though, so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d has at least been able to generate positive FCF in the past.

Our Take On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d's Profit Performance

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d didn't convert much of its profit to free cash flow in the last year, which some investors may consider rather suboptimal. Therefore, it seems possible to us that Hwaxin EnvironmentalLtd's true underlying earnings power is actually less than its statutory profit. In further bad news, its earnings per share decreased in the last year.
